Como filtrar itens do glossário

Crie um filtro

Vá para Painel do WordPress > Filtros Inteligentes > Adicionar Novo . 

Preencha um Nome de Filtro e escolha o Tipo de Filtro desejado .

Coisas para saber

A fonte de dados “Glossário” pode ser usada apenas com o tipo de filtro “ Selecionar ”, “ Rádio ” e “ Lista de caixas de seleção ” .

Se você escolher a opção “Lista de caixas de seleção”, verifique as seguintes configurações.

Lembre-se de escolher a fonte de dados “JetEngine Glossary” e o item necessário no campo Selecionar glossário .

filtro de lista de caixas de seleção
Coisas para saber

Como você pode notar, o campo Variável de Consulta é obrigatório para completar as configurações do filtro. Aqui, você deve colocar o valor Nome/ID anexado ao metacampo do glossário do Custom Post Type , Custom Content Type , options page ou meta box (o objeto com o qual você está trabalhando).

Por exemplo, veja o exemplo apresentado. Nesse caso, pegamos o Nome/ID das configurações de Tipo de postagem personalizada , cujas postagens queremos filtrar eventualmente.

metacampo da caixa de seleção

Os mesmos passos devem ser seguidos se você quiser construir um filtro “Rádio”.

filtro de rádio

Você também pode criar um tipo de filtro “Selecionar” para cobrir as opções do glossário em um menu suspenso.

selecione filtro

Agora, tomaremos o tipo de filtro “Lista de caixas de seleção” como exemplo para o caso de uso descrito.

Pressione o botão “ Atualizar ” para salvar as alterações feitas no filtro.

Adicionar filtro à página

Navegue até o diretório Painel do WordPress > Páginas e abra/adicione uma nova página para colocar o filtro nela. As páginas podem ser feitas com Gutenberg, Elementor ou Bricks.

Agora, vamos abrir a página editada pelo Elementor.

Aqui, encontre e coloque um dos widgets necessários na página: Checkboxes , Radio ou Select Filter .

Escolhemos o filtro recém-criado no campo Selecionar filtro e definimos seu provedor no campo Este filtro para : como queremos trabalhar com o widget Listing Grid , ele será “JetEngine”. No entanto, você pode usar qualquer outro provedor de filtro, se necessário.

caixas de seleção filtram configurações de conteúdo

Opcionalmente, você pode prosseguir para outras guias de personalização do widget de filtro. Para o widget Filtro de caixas de seleção , são Configurações adicionais e Opções do indexador .

Queremos mostrar o número de postagens disponíveis próximo às opções de filtro, então vamos para a guia Opções do Indexador e ativamos o botão Aplicar Indexador . Em seguida, ativamos o botão Mostrar contador . 

Por enquanto, no editor, não conseguimos ver o contador correto ao lado do item. No entanto, o indexador funcionará corretamente no front-end.

guia de opções do indexador de filtro de caixa de seleção
Aviso

Se você quiser usar um indexador com seu filtro baseado no glossário, certifique-se de que o valor do campo de todos os campos do glossário possa conter apenas letras latinas minúsculas, números, símbolos “-” e “_” para separar palavras, sem espaços. Caso contrário, o indexador não funcionará.

valores do glossário

A seguir, adicionamos um widget Listing Grid a esta página, pois ele servirá como provedor para o filtro. 

Personalize a página se desejar e pressione o botão “ Publicar/Atualizar ”.

listagem de grade no elementor

Verifique o resultado abrindo a página que você acabou de editar no front end. Os itens do glossário agora estão disponíveis para seleção no filtro. 

Além disso, se você ajustou o indexador, verá o contador próximo às opções de filtro.

filtro na parte frontal

Agora, escolha a(s) opção(ões) desejada(s) para ver se o filtro funciona.

listagem filtrada

Isso é tudo; agora você sabe como filtrar itens do glossário com a ajuda dos plug-ins JetEngine e JetSmartFilters em seu site WordPress.

Índice